Lakshya Sharma 8d154e6c2a fix(benchmarks): strip block comments before counting LOC (#232)
loc.js filtered comments line by line, so /* ... */ block comments whose
continuation lines are not *-aligned had their inner lines counted as code.
A plain indented block comment scored higher than the same code written
JSDoc-style. Strip /* ... */ before the line count so both are equal, and
add loc.test.js to lock the behavior.

Fixes #231

Lakshya77089 795ec0ee36 fix: statusline reads flag from CLAUDE_CONFIG_DIR, not just ~/.claude (#34 follow-up) (#154)
Issue #34 made the hooks honor CLAUDE_CONFIG_DIR when writing the mode flag
($CLAUDE_CONFIG_DIR/.ponytail-active), enforced by tests/hooks.test.js. But
both statusline scripts still hardcoded $HOME/.claude/.ponytail-active, so any
user with CLAUDE_CONFIG_DIR set gets no badge — or a stale mode from a
pre-migration ~/.claude flag that never updates again.

Make both scripts resolve the flag the same way getClaudeDir() does: prefer
CLAUDE_CONFIG_DIR, fall back to ~/.claude. The fallback branch is identical to
the previous behavior, so unset-env users are unaffected. Also corrects the
now-inaccurate path comment in the activation hook header.

Lakshya77089 c30854118e fix: guard final writeHookOutput against stdout EPIPE in ponytail-activate (#149) (#152)
The final writeHookOutput('SessionStart', ...) call was the only operation
in the file outside a try/catch. writeHookOutput ends in a bare
process.stdout.write, so a closed stdout / broken pipe (EPIPE) at hook exit
throws uncaught and crashes the hook with a non-zero exit code. Wrap it to
match the file's existing never-block-session-start posture.

Lakshya77089 a3bc7db722 fix: strip UTF-8 BOM before parsing settings.json in ponytail-activate (#148) (#151)
settings.json written by Notepad or VS Code on Windows can carry a
UTF-8 BOM. JSON.parse then throws SyntaxError, the outer catch swallows
it, hasStatusline stays false, and the statusline setup nudge is never
emitted.

Strip the leading BOM before parsing, matching the existing handling in
ponytail-mode-tracker.js. (#96 added a null guard but not BOM stripping.)

Lakshya77089 53fd1e850e fix: only deactivate on a standalone "stop ponytail" / "normal mode" (#162)
The deactivation check matched the phrase anywhere in the prompt, so an
ordinary request like "add a normal mode toggle" silently turned ponytail
off for the rest of the session. Match the whole message instead (trimmed,
case-insensitive, trailing punctuation ignored) through a shared helper used
by both the Claude/Codex hook and the pi extension.

Fixes #161
